* amd64-linux-tdep.h: Remove file.
* amd64-linux-tdep.c: Don't include "inferior.h" and "amd64-linux-tdep.h". Include "frame.h" and "solib-svr4.h". (USER_R15, USER_R14, USER_R13, USER_R12, USER_RBP, USER_RBX) (USER_R11, USER_R10, USER_R9, USER_R8, USER_RAX, USER_RCX) (USER_RDX, USER_RSI, USER_RDI, USER_RIP, USER_CS, USER_EFLAGS) (USER_RSP, USER_SS, USER_DS, USER_ES, USER_FS, USER_GS): Remove macros. (user_to_gdb_regmap): Remove variable. (amd64_linux_gregset_reg_offset): New variable. (amd64_core_fns): Remove variable. (fetch_core_registers): Remove function. (amd64_linux_supply_gregset, amd64_linux_fill_gregset): Remove functions. (_initialize_amd64_linux_tdep): Don't set add_core_fns. * amd64-linux-nat.c: Don't include "amd64-linux-tdep.h". * Makefile.in (amd64_linux_tdep_h): Remove. (amd64-linux-nat.o): Update dependencies. (amd64-linux-tdep.o): Update dependencies.
